CEREMONIAL PRESENTATIONS <br /> CEREMONIAL PRESENTATION NOS. 1 AND 2 WERE CONTINUED TO A LATER <br /> DATE <br /> 1. Certificates of Recognition presented by Mayor Amezcua recognizing Vex <br /> Robotics World Championship Participants for Outstanding Academic <br /> Accomplishments <br /> 2. Certificate of Recognition presented by Councilmember Bacerra recognizing <br /> Orange County's Fire Authority Best and Bravest Outstanding Contributions <br /> to the Community <br /> 3. Certificate of Recognition presented by Councilmember Lopez to The <br /> Nobody's for Outstanding Contributions to the Community <br /> MINUTES: Councilmember Lopez presented a certificate of recognition to The <br /> Nobody's for outstanding contributions to the community. <br /> 4. Proclamation presented by Councilmember Phan to The Harbor Institute for <br /> Immigrant and Economic Justice declaring June 2025 as Immigrant Heritage <br /> Month <br /> MINUTES: Councilmember Phan presented a proclamation to The Harbor Institute <br /> for Immigrant and Economic Justice declaring June 2025 as Immigrant Heritage <br /> Month. <br /> CLOSED SESSION REPORT—The City Attorney will report on any action(s)from Closed <br /> Session. <br /> MINUTES: City Attorney Sonia Carvalho reported for Closed Session Item No. 1A <br /> Council settled the case by a vote of 6-1 (Councilmember Hernandez dissenting) in <br /> the amount of$150,000; for Closed Session Item No. 1 B Council settled the case by <br /> a vote of 6-1 (Councilmember Hernandez dissenting) in the amount of$115,000; for <br /> Closed Session Item No. 3 Council settled the case by a vote of 7-0 in the amount of <br /> $56,500; and for Closed Session Item No. 2 Council voted 5-2 (Mayor Pro Tem <br /> Vazquez and Councilmember Hernandez dissenting) to discontinue further work on <br /> the councilmember generated policy proposal that was discussed at the May 20, 2025 <br /> City Council meeting. <br /> PUBLIC COMMENTS.—Public comments will be held during the beginning of the meeting <br /> for ALL comments on agenda items. <br /> MINUTES. City Clerk Jennifer L. Hall reported out the summary of email comments <br /> received. one (1) Agenda Item No. 20, three (3) Agenda Item No. 22, and (27) non- <br /> agenda comments. <br /> CITY COUNCIL 4 JUNE 17, 2025 <br />
